IMG Academy barely beat East St. Louis the last time the pair played, but that sure wasn't the case this time around. The Ascenders were the clear victors by  a  38-14 margin over the Flyers on Saturday. The  win continues a trend for the Ascenders in their matchups with the Flyers: they've now won three in a row.

IMG Academy was led to victory by  Le'Khy Thompkins and  Jayden Wade.  Thompkins rushed for 214 yards while picking up 8.6 yards per carry, while  Wade rushed for 72 yards. Those  214  rushing yards gave  Thompkins a new career-high.
 They were just one part of a punishing run game: IMG Academy was unstoppable on the ground and  finished the game with 286  rushing yards. That's the most  rushing yards they've managed all season.
 On the other side of the ball, a lot of the credit has to go to IMG Academy's defense and their three sacks. The team can thank three different players for their defensive prowess:  Zyron Forstall,  Christopher Ah-Loe,  and  James Morrow, who each picked up one  sack apiece.  Jake Kreul was another major factor on D,  forcing two fumbles, making five total tackles (2.0 for loss),  and defending one pass.
IMG Academy's victory bumped their record up to 8-0. As for East St. Louis,  with the  loss, they broke their five-game winning streak and moved their record to 5-3.
